**Action item (security review requested):** Following the Brindlecore incident, tighten the Lexwatch typo-squat scanner's edit-distance matching so near-miss package names are flagged before mirror sync, not after. Owner: registry-integrity team. Please verify the new thresholds don't suppress legitimate forks, and confirm quarantine actions are logged immutably. The proposed matching and quarantine constants are as follows.

tuning constants:
QUOTAS = {
    "druwyn": 5,
    "holix": 5,
    "zorath": 5,
    "holwyn": 10,
}

# Hey, welcome to the Bannerly consent-rollout config! # This env file drives the staged rollout of the new consent banner # across the Fenwick regions. Most values below are safe defaults — # tweak COHORT_PERCENT if you're testing locally, leave the rest alone. # One thing the sample file can't include: the rollout service needs # its auth credential to talk to the consent API. Add this line first:

env line for fafof-fahag: LEDGER_TOKEN5=f8790

- [ ] **Telemetry payload compression (Ravenhollow agent):** Verify that all outbound telemetry from the Ravenhollow agent is compressed with the approved codec, that the uncompressed fallback is logged, and that payload sizes stay under the gateway cap. Sample at least one batch per region. Findings go in the audit sheet; open questions should be directed to the owner named below.

approver of yawig-yajef = Briius Jorix